Job Summary

In addition to the responsibilities listed above, this position is also responsible for providing classroom, web-based, and one-on-one training to technical staff; leveraging working knowledge of products, clinical, and operational workflows, identifying application enhancements into each curriculum trained; training on product, processes, content, and system updates and optimization for multiple applications; monitoring end-user support during system and content go-lives and annual application upgrades and addressing standard end users system issues; monitoring analysis of client business processes and functional application requirements; documenting the validation processes for the development and maintenance of the training environment; and potentially providing support to problem resolution of information systems related issues and escalating non-standard concerns from users/clinical/training personnel.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elors Degree in business, communication, education, behavioral science, or a directly related field, OR Minimum three (3) years of experience in training delivery, curriculum design, training development and evaluation, or a directly related field.

Additional Requirements

  •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ities (KSAs): Written Communication; Content Development; Coordination

Preferred Qualifications

  • Two (2) years of experience with eLearning development tools and virtual learning technologies.
  • Two (2) years of experience administering Learning Management Systems (LMSs).
